1."Carbon Nanomaterials (Advanced Materials and Technologies)" by Yury Gogotsi and Volker Presser
“Carbon Nanomaterials (Advanced Materials and Technologies)” Book Review: This book is a comprehensive overview of Carbon Nanotubes (CNTs) and related carbon-based nanomaterials. It covers various aspects such as electronic, mechanical, optical, and chemical characteristics of CNTs, along with their synthesis, special properties, and real-life applications. The book also includes information on other carbon-based nanomaterials like fullerenes, nano-diamonds, fibers, cones, scrolls, whiskers, and graphite polyhedral crystals. Additionally, it delves into the surface chemistry and science and engineering applications of these materials, including solar cells, electrical hydrogen storage, molecular electronics, and censoring. Furthermore, the book covers nano- and micro-electromechanical devices, field-emission displays, energy storage, and composite materials.

2."Carbon Nanomaterials, Second Edition (Advanced Materials and Technologies)" by Yury Gogotsi and Volker Presser
“Carbon Nanomaterials, Second Edition (Advanced Materials and Technologies)” Book Review: This book is a comprehensive guide on carbon nanomaterials, covering their synthesis, properties, and applications. It delves into the fascinating world of carbon nanomaterials such as graphene, which is an atomically flat carbon, and carbon onions, which are carbon nanospheres. The book is a valuable resource for undergraduates, PhD students, newcomers to the field, and industry professionals seeking knowledge on carbon nanomaterials.

3."Chemical Functionalization of Carbon Nanomaterials: Chemistry and Applications" by Manju Kumari Thakur and Vijay Kumar Thakur
“Chemical Functionalization of Carbon Nanomaterials: Chemistry and Applications” Book Review: In this book, the Chemical Functionalization of Carbon Nanomaterials is succinctly outlined, with a comprehensive coverage of their various applications. These include the automotive, packaging, and coating industries, as well as the biomedical sector. Furthermore, the book expounds on the inherent limitations of carbon nanomaterials and delves into their analytical chemistry, drug delivery, and water treatment potential. Additionally, the applicability of carbon nanomaterials is elucidated, while future developments in this field are also discussed.

4."Carbon Nanomaterials in Clean Energy Hydrogen Systems (NATO Science for Peace and Security Series C: Environmental Security)" by Bogdan Baranowski and Svetlana Zaginaichenko
“Carbon Nanomaterials in Clean Energy Hydrogen Systems (NATO Science for Peace and Security Series C: Environmental Security)” Book Review: This book provides a comprehensive overview of Carbon Nanomaterials, their chemical behavior, and their applications in the energy field. It delves into the transition towards hydrogen-based energy systems, detailing the technologies for hydrogen production, storage, and utilization. The book also covers carbon nanomaterials processing, energy, and environmental problems, and explores the research and technological applications of hydrogen. It highlights the concepts, processes, and systems related to hydrogen and promotes its pivotal role in the energy sector, while also featuring the significance of carbon nanomaterials in this field.

5."Carbon Nanomaterials for Advanced Energy Systems: Advances in Materials Synthesis and Device Applications" by Jong–Beom Baek and Liming Dai
“Carbon Nanomaterials for Advanced Energy Systems: Advances in Materials Synthesis and Device Applications” Book Review: This book provides a comprehensive overview of the synthesis and characterization of carbon nanomaterials, as well as their applications in addressing the dwindling supplies of fossil fuels and the increasing need for electric power. It offers a systematic coverage of a wide range of carbon nanomaterials, including solar cells, electrodes, thermoelectrics, supercapacitors, and lithium-ion-based storage, among others. In addition, this book delves into the special architecture and explains the use of carbon nanomaterials in energy applications such as hydrogen and methane. Overall, this book is a valuable resource for anyone seeking to gain a deeper understanding of the synthesis, characterization, and applications of carbon nanomaterials.

6."Two-Dimensional Carbon: Fundamental Properties, Synthesis, Characterization, and Applications (Pan Stanford Series on Carbon-Based Nanomaterials)" by Wu Yihong
“Two-Dimensional Carbon: Fundamental Properties, Synthesis, Characterization, and Applications (Pan Stanford Series on Carbon-Based Nanomaterials)” Book Review: This book provides a comprehensive overview of the fundamental properties of graphene, including its synthesis and characterization. It covers a wide range of topics related to the application of various two-dimensional (2D) nanocarbons, such as graphene, carbon nanowalls, and graphene oxides. The growth of graphene on SiC and its chemical synthesis on metal are also discussed. The book delves into chemical vapor deposition and explains the use of Raman spectroscopy in analyzing 2D nanocarbons. Additionally, it explores the applications of graphene in supercapacitors, lithium-ion batteries, and fuel cells.

7."Carbon Nanomaterials for Gas Adsorption" by Maria Letizia Terranova and Silvia Orlanducci
“Carbon Nanomaterials for Gas Adsorption” Book Review: This book presents a selection of intriguing scientific discoveries concerning the exceptional attributes of carbon nanomaterials in gas adsorption. It is suitable for both fundamental research and practical applications. The volume concentrates on crucial concepts like hydrogen storage, hydrogen purification, gas trapping, and separation. Additionally, it highlights the storage of rare gases, adsorption of organic vapors, and the metrology of gas adsorption.
